Resumo

Samples of cerium(IV) tungstate (CeW) inorganic ion exchanger were synthesized using different Ce(IV) salts: (NH4)2Ce(NO3)6·2H2O, (NH4)4Ce(SO4)4·2H2O, and Ce(SO4)2·4H2O. The samples were characterized using FT-IR and X-ray diffraction. The adsorption behavior of 152+154Eu(III) and 60Co(II) on CeW was studied under batch and dynamic conditions. Factors influencing the adsorption kinetics were examined. Loading and elution behavior of both ions was studied using different eluents. Complete separation of Eu(III) and Co(II) (152+154Eu and 60Co tracers) was achieved using small columns packed with CeW.
